Auto 13 Best-Looking Cars January 16, 2019January 29, 2023 Girish 8 Comments Acura NSX, Aston Martin Vanquish, Audi A7, Awesome Looking Cars of 2017, BMW i8 coupe, car, Dodge Viper ACR, Ford GT, Ford Mustang Shelby GT350, Jaguar F-Type SVR, Lamborghini Aventador, Mercedes-Benz G63 AMG In this article, I am going to just list down the cars that look awesome. If the car you like Read more